There are no Yenko's shown to have 588xxx as a VIN. The latest shown in that range would be 587xxx. I don't believe there were any X22 Yenkos either. There were X66 Yenkos but they appear to all be 01B cars. Remember, Yenko ordered his cars as stripped down cars with standard interior and usually no exterior trim so an X22 trim car wouldn't fit in place with his first order of cars.
